Why 5G NTN Is the Next Big Wave
Picture this: a world where your phone gets bars atop Mount Everest, deep in the Amazon, or mid-Pacific on a cruise ship. That’s the promise of 5G NTN—using satellites and airborne tech to beam high-speed internet where traditional towers can’t tread. Rural villages? Check. Disaster zones? Double-check. Even your next transatlantic flight could stream Netflix smoother than a yacht gliding through calm seas.
The secret sauce? Hybrid networks. By marrying terrestrial 5G with satellites, NTN creates a backup lifeline when hurricanes knock out cell towers or when IoT devices in Siberia need to phone home. It’s like having a fleet of communication lifeboats ready to deploy.

Three Tides Driving the 5G NTN Boom
1. Bridging the Digital Divide (Because Not Everyone Lives in Manhattan)
Let’s face it: telecom companies aren’t racing to install fiber optics in the Sahara or the Andes. Ground infrastructure is pricey, and ROI in remote areas moves slower than a tugboat. Enter NTN:
– Satellites like SpaceX’s Starlink are already blanketing the globe.
– High-altitude pseudo-satellites (HAPS)—think solar-powered drones—hover for months, beaming signals to hard-to-reach spots.
Asia Pacific is leading the charge, thanks to its sprawling geography and booming IoT demand (smart rice paddies, anyone?).
2. SOS: Disaster-Proof Connectivity
When earthquakes, floods, or wildfires strike, terrestrial networks often go dark. NTN is the emergency flare of comms:
– First responders can coordinate rescues via satellite-linked devices.
– AI-powered drones with NTN backhaul can map disaster zones in real time.
Imagine Hurricane Katrina with 5G NTN—fewer blackouts, faster aid. That’s not just tech; it’s lifesaving.
3. Sky-High Industries: Aviation, Maritime, and Defense
– Airlines: Passengers demand Wi-Fi at 30,000 feet. NTN’s low latency could make Zoom calls mid-flight less glitchy than a dial-up modem.
– Shipping: Cargo ships navigating the Arctic? NTN keeps them connected for GPS, weather updates, and crew TikTok binges (hey, morale matters).
– Military: Secure, jamming-proof comms for troops in hostile terrain? NTN’s the navy seal of networks.

Storm Clouds on the Horizon
No voyage is without squalls, and NTN’s got a few:
– Costs: Launching satellites ain’t cheap. A single rocket ride can burn $60 million—enough to buy a small island (or a very fancy yacht).
– Regulatory Bermuda Triangle: Who owns the airwaves? Governments and telecoms are still duking it out over spectrum rights.
– Tech Hiccups: Miniaturizing satellites and slashing latency is like teaching a whale to tap dance—possible, but tricky.
Yet, innovation’s trimming the sails. AI-driven network optimization and reusable rockets (thanks, Elon) are cutting costs. And as IoT devices multiply like seagulls at a fish market, demand will keep prices sinking.
